Product Description: Includes background information on major psychological paradigms and research methods. Includes an overview of law, its functions, its methods, and judicial processes. Contains a chapter dedicated to forensic clinical assessment and an appendix with the major diagnostic criteria for mental disorders that have particular relevance to forensic psychology...read more
